Understanding the Microbial Metropolis: Why Your Pet's Gut Needs Time to Adapt

Think of your pet's digestive system not as a simple tube, but as a complex, thriving ecosystem—a microbial metropolis. This gut microbiome, comprising trillions of bacteria, fungi, and other microorganisms, is finely tuned to digest and extract nutrients from the food it regularly encounters. A diet of highly processed kibble fosters a specific bacterial community adept at breaking down starches and plant-based fillers. In contrast, a biologically appropriate raw or freeze-dried diet like those from stella & chewy's, which is rich in animal protein, fat, and moisture, requires a different set of microbial workers.

A sudden, wholesale switch from kibble to raw is akin to replacing an entire city's workforce overnight. The new "employees" (bacteria suited for raw food) aren't yet established, while the old ones are overwhelmed by unfamiliar tasks. This chaos manifests as digestive distress: loose stools, gas, vomiting, or a refusal to eat. Furthermore, the pancreas and liver, which produce enzymes for digestion, also need time to adjust their output to the new macronutrient profile. A gradual transition allows for a peaceful, orderly microbial succession, giving the gut time to ramp up enzyme production and build a robust population of bacteria suited to the new, nutrient-dense diet from stella & chewy's.

A Blueprint for Success: The Gradual Transition Timeline

Patience is the cornerstone of a successful switch. Rushing this process is the most common mistake. The following week-by-week plan provides a structured framework. Remember, this is a guideline; sensitive pets may need an even slower, 14-day approach.

Transition PhaseFood Ratio (Old Food : New stella & chewy's)Key Actions & Monitoring Points
Days 1-275% Old Food / 25% New FoodIntroduce a small amount of rehydrated freeze-dried patty or raw morsel. Mix thoroughly. Closely monitor stool consistency and appetite. Ensure your pet is drinking plenty of water, especially when feeding freeze-dried.
Days 3-450% Old Food / 50% New FoodThe halfway point. Continue thorough mixing. Observe energy levels and coat condition for early positive signs. Stool may be softer but should not be liquid.
Days 5-725% Old Food / 75% New FoodYour pet is now eating predominantly stella & chewy's. Watch for normalization of stool. If any signs of upset occur, pause at this ratio for 2-3 extra days.
Day 8+100% stella & chewy'sFull transition. Feed the recommended amount based on your pet's weight and activity level. Maintain consistent feeding times.

Navigating Bumps in the Road: Practical Troubleshooting Strategies

Even with a perfect plan, some pets present unique challenges. Here’s how to handle common scenarios:

For the Picky Eater: Some pets are suspicious of new textures. For stella & chewy's freeze-dried dinners, ensure they are fully rehydrated with warm water to release the aroma. You can also try crumbling a freeze-dried raw meal mixer as a "topper" on their old food initially, creating a positive association. Patience and avoiding frantic food changes are key; offer the mixed meal for 15-20 minutes, then remove it until the next scheduled feeding.

For the Pet with a Known Sensitive Stomach: Extend the timeline. Spend 3-4 days at each ratio stage instead of 2. Consider starting with a single-protein formula from stella & chewy's, such as lamb or duck, which are often novel proteins for pets used to chicken-based kibble and may be less likely to trigger sensitivities. A study in the Journal of Animal Physiology and Animal Nutrition noted that dietary transitions using limited-ingredient, high-protein diets could improve fecal consistency in sensitive dogs when introduced gradually.

If Digestive Issues Arise: Should soft stool or diarrhea occur, do not panic and immediately revert to the old diet. This resets the process. Instead, take a step back. Return to the previous ratio where stools were normal and hold there for 3-5 days before attempting to move forward again. Adding a veterinarian-approved probiotic supplement can help support the microbiome during this adjustment. If vomiting, severe diarrhea, or lethargy occurs, pause the transition and consult your veterinarian to rule out other causes.

Required Technical Features

Create a detailed specification list. Key parameters include:

  • Resolution & Frame Rate: 1080p at 60fps is the current standard for dynamic content. 4K is becoming more prevalent for future-proofing and high-end production.
  • Sensor Size & Low-Light Performance: A larger sensor (e.g., 1-inch, Micro Four Thirds, APS-C) typically yields better image quality, especially in varying lighting conditions common in home studios.
  • Connectivity: USB plug-and-play (UVC compliant) is essential for simplicity. HDMI offers uncompressed video for capture cards. For professional setups, SDI provides robust, long-distance signal transmission.
  • Specialized Features: This is where terms like "motion tracking" and "PTZ" become critical. Do you need AI-powered auto-framing to keep a moving subject in shot? Do you require preset positions that can be recalled at the touch of a button?

I. Defining Custom Printed and Traditional Challenge Coins

The world of commemorative and recognition tokens is rich with tradition and innovation, with two primary manufacturing methods standing out: custom and traditional die-struck coins. Understanding their fundamental differences is the first step in making an informed choice. At its core, the distinction lies in the production technique. Custom printed coins , also known as offset printed or pad printed coins, utilize a digital or screen-printing process. A design is printed directly onto a pre-struck, smooth metal blank, typically made of zinc alloy, brass, or iron. This method allows for full-color, photographic-quality images, gradients, and intricate details to be transferred onto the coin's surface with high precision. The process is akin to high-quality printing on paper, but adapted for metal.

In contrast, traditional die-struck coins are created through a centuries-old method of minting. A hardened steel die, engraved with the coin's design in negative relief, is struck with immense pressure (often hundreds of tons) onto a metal planchet (blank). This force displaces the metal, raising the design elements to create a three-dimensional, sculpted effect. This process results in the classic raised (relief) and recessed (incuse) areas that give traditional coins their distinctive tactile and visual weight.

The variations in design options are significant. Printed coins excel in color reproduction and detail complexity. You can incorporate logos, portraits, landscapes, and complex graphics with virtually no limitation on the number of colors or subtle shading. However, the design remains largely flat on the surface. Traditional coins offer superior dimensionality. While color application (through soft or hard enamel) is possible, the design's impact comes from the depth, texture, and play of light on the raised metal. Fine lines and very small text can be more challenging to achieve with die-striking compared to printing.

Cost implications are immediately apparent. The setup for traditional die-struck coins involves the costly and time-consuming creation of custom steel dies. This makes them less economical for small runs. For instance, in Hong Kong's manufacturing sector, a single custom die can cost anywhere from HKD $1,500 to HKD $4,000, a fixed cost that must be amortized over the production run. have minimal setup costs, as the "die" is a digital file. Therefore, for orders below 500 units, printed coins often present a substantially lower per-unit cost. The cost crossover point where traditional coins become more economical per piece usually occurs at higher quantities (e.g., 1,000+ pieces), where the die cost is spread thin.

III. Advantages of Traditional Die-Struck Coins

Despite the technological appeal of printing, traditional die-struck coins hold an enduring, prestigious position in the market. Their advantages are rooted in tangible quality, perception, and longevity.

The premium look and feel is unmistakable. The weight of the metal (often bronze, silver, or brass), the crisp, sharp edges from the strike, and the three-dimensional relief create a sensory experience. You can feel the design with your fingertips. The "ping" sound when dropped on a surface and the substantial heft convey quality. The process allows for intricate sculpting, antique finishes, and edge lettering—features that are difficult or impossible to replicate with printing. This tactile and visual sophistication is why military units, government agencies, and high-end corporate awards have historically favored die-struck coins.

They carry a perceived higher value , both emotionally and materially. The knowledge that a unique die was crafted and that each coin was individually struck adds to its narrative and worth. In a culture of recognition, receiving a die-struck coin often feels more significant than receiving a printed one, as it is associated with heritage, permanence, and substantial effort. This perception can enhance the coin's effectiveness as a motivational tool or a cherished keepsake. In collectible markets, especially in places like Hong Kong with active numismatic communities, die-struck coins typically hold and appreciate in value better than their printed counterparts.

Durability and longevity are paramount. The raised metal design of a die-struck coin is extremely resistant to wear. The color, if filled with hard enamel, is recessed and protected by the surrounding metal ridges. Even after years of handling, the core design remains legible and attractive. Printed coins , while durable with modern coatings, have the design layer on the surface. Abrasion over time can potentially wear down the printed image, especially on high points. For coins meant to be carried daily (like challenge coins), passed down through generations, or exposed to harsh environments, the inherent durability of die-striking is a decisive factor.

V. Comparing Material Options

Both coin types offer a variety of material and finish choices, which profoundly affect their appearance, cost, and feel. Understanding these options allows for further customization within your chosen manufacturing method.

Metal choices and their characteristics vary. For custom printed coins , the most common base metal is zinc alloy (zamak). It's cost-effective, takes printing excellently, and can be plated to mimic other metals. Brass and iron are also used. Traditional die-struck coins commonly use:

  • Brass: A classic, warm gold-colored alloy, durable and takes beautiful antiquing finishes.
  • Bronze: Slightly redder than brass, often associated with high-quality medals and coins, develops a desirable patina over time.
  • Copper: Has a distinctive reddish hue, very malleable for striking fine detail.
  • Nickel Silver: Actually contains no silver; it's a silvery-white, hard alloy that provides a bright, tarnish-resistant finish.
  • Precious Metals: Silver or gold plating, or even solid sterling silver, are options for ultra-premium die-struck coins.

Finish options and their impact on appearance are crucial. For printed coins, a clear protective epoxy coating is standard, giving a glossy, domed effect that enhances color vibrancy. Traditional coins offer a wider range of finishes:

  • Polished (Proof-like): A mirror-like background with frosted design elements.
  • Antique: A darkened finish that highlights the high points of the design, giving an aged, distinguished look.
  • Satin/Matte: A non-reflective, brushed finish.
  • Sandblasted: Creates a textured, frosted background for contrast.

Enamel and color fill techniques differ. Printed coins have color applied as part of the printing process. For traditional coins, color is added via enamel fills:

  • Soft Enamel: Enamel is filled to just below the raised metal lines, leaving a tactile, textured surface. This is cost-effective and common.
  • Hard Enamel (Cloisonné): The enamel is filled flush to the metal edges, then polished flat. This creates a smooth, glossy, and extremely durable surface, representing the highest quality color application for die-struck coins.

The choice here affects both aesthetics and durability, with hard enamel being superior for long-term wear.

III. Cost Considerations

Understanding the cost structure of printed coins is crucial to navigating the market. The most obvious factor is the Price per Coin. This can range dramatically. Based on market research in Hong Kong and Asia-Pacific manufacturing hubs, prices for basic, small-run custom printed coins can start as low as HKD $3 to $8 (approx. USD $0.38 - $1.02) per piece for simple designs on zinc alloy with basic printing. Mid-range coins, using brass with soft enamel printing and a standard plating, might range from HKD $15 to $30 (USD $1.92 - $3.84) each. High-end pieces, featuring intricate multi-color hard enamel, special antique finishes, or unique shapes on premium metals, can easily cost HKD $50 (USD $6.40) or more per unit. The table below illustrates a typical price breakdown based on quality tier:

Quality Tier Typical Material Printing Technique Estimated Price per Coin (HKD) Estimated Price per Coin (USD)
Budget Zinc Alloy Pad / Basic Screen Print $3 - $8 $0.38 - $1.02
Standard Brass, Pewter Soft Enamel, Offset Print $15 - $30 $1.92 - $3.84
Premium Bronze, Nickel Silver Hard Enamel, Multi-Step Plating $50+$6.40+

However, the quoted price per coin is frequently just the tip of the iceberg. Hidden Costs can significantly inflate your final invoice. These commonly include:

  • Setup/Mold Fee: A one-time charge for creating the custom die or mold, which can range from HKD $500 to $3000+ (USD $64 - $384), depending on complexity.
  • Design Revision Fees: Some suppliers charge for each round of design proofs beyond the first two.
  • Shipping and Import Duties: Especially relevant when ordering from overseas manufacturers. Express shipping and customs clearance fees can add 20-30% to the product cost.
  • Minimum Order Quantity (MOQ): A lower per-coin price might be contingent on a very high MOQ, locking up capital in inventory.
  • Payment Processing Fees: For international wire transfers or certain online payment platforms.

Always request a detailed, all-inclusive quote.

One of the most effective ways to manage cost is through Bulk Discounts. The unit price almost always decreases as order volume increases. This is because the fixed costs (like the mold fee) are amortized over more units, and production efficiency improves. For example, a supplier might quote HKD $25 per coin for 100 pieces but only HKD $18 per coin for 500 pieces, and HKD $12 per coin for 2000 pieces. This makes custom printed coins significantly more economical for large-scale events, long-term employee recognition programs, or major promotional campaigns. When comparing quotes, ensure you are comparing identical quantities to get a true cost comparison.

Core Characteristics: Structure, Materials, and Applications

Let's break down what defines each technique, starting from the foundation upwards. is the most common and traditional form. It involves stitching thread directly onto the fabric's surface, creating a design that lies flush with the material. It uses standard embroidery threads and backings, resulting in a detailed, polished, and two-dimensional appearance. This technique excels at reproducing intricate logos, fine text, and complex multi-color designs with high fidelity.

Next, we have 3D Puff Embroidery , a technique specifically designed to add a raised, textured effect. The magic lies in a special foam layer that is placed underneath the stitches. The embroidery machine stitches over and around this foam, and once the design is complete, the excess foam is carefully removed or heat-treated. This process leaves the embroidered areas—typically the thicker outlines or block letters—standing up from the fabric with a soft, padded, three-dimensional feel. It's less about visual depth illusion and more about tangible, physical height.

The term is broader and can be a bit more nuanced. In a general sense, it refers to any embroidery that creates a pronounced three-dimensional effect. 3D Puff Embroidery is actually a primary subset of this category. However, other methods achieve a 3D look without foam. This can involve using dense, layered stitching techniques, varying stitch directions, or combining different thread types to build up areas and create shadows and highlights that trick the eye into seeing depth on a flat surface. Sometimes, it also refers to complex multi-layer embroidery where elements are stitched separately and assembled, creating a truly dimensional object attached to the fabric.

Durability & Practicality: Washability, Wear, and Cost

When investing in custom embroidery, longevity and practicality are key. Flat Embroidery is highly durable and washable. The stitches are tight and secure, and with proper stabilizer, they resist puckering and wear exceptionally well over many washes. It's also the most cost-effective option, requiring less specialized material and often less machine time, making it ideal for large orders like corporate uniforms.

3D Puff Embroidery is also quite durable, but its raised nature makes it more susceptible to snagging on sharp objects or getting crushed under heavy, abrasive pressure. The foam inside can break down over extreme heat, so it's generally advised to avoid ironing directly on the design and to use a gentle wash cycle. Cost-wise, it is more expensive than flat embroidery due to the extra material (foam) and the additional step of foam removal.

The durability of other 3D Embroidery techniques varies greatly depending on the method. Dense, layered stitching is very robust, while delicate, thread-built dimensional effects might be more fragile. Multi-layer assembled pieces could have points of weakness at the attachments. These advanced techniques are typically the most expensive, reflecting the high level of skill, time, and sometimes manual labor required. They are an investment in art and high fashion.
